The PhD program in Psychology trains students at the highest level in one of three specialty areas of psychology: Brain, Behavior, and Cognition (BBC), Developmental Science (DS), and Clinical (C). John B. Watson is known as the founder of behaviorism. The Department remains committed to the belief that the best training for a career in ... 70 east custom cartspenn state sorority rankings 2023 The study of human social behavior is called sociology, while the study of the individual human mind and behavior is called psychology. introduction conflict resolution Behavioral Decision Research (BDR) is an interdisciplinary field that draws on insights from psychology and economics to provide a descriptively realistic picture of human decision making.
